Output 51d6a3b7052f0408cbe313b13029a1ed333dbaf300b755a069ce5dcc45dcf6d9:19

value
274705
script pubkey
OP_0 OP_PUSHBYTES_20 3dc840f21fecae1af8f96ab512f003067ac8b8ad
address
bc1q8hyypuslajhp478ed2639uqrqeav3w9d8y2334
transaction
51d6a3b7052f0408cbe313b13029a1ed333dbaf300b755a069ce5dcc45dcf6d9